⭐ Featured Snippet — What is a Picker and Packer?
Definition: A picker and packer is a warehouse operative who locates products from shelves or pick faces using a pick list or handheld scanner, then packs, labels and prepares those orders for dispatch. The role is central to e-commerce fulfilment, retail distribution and 3PL warehouse operations, combining stock accuracy, packing speed and dispatch readiness into a single workflow.

5. Duties of Picker and Packer Staff
A typical picker and packer day inside a Manchester fulfilment warehouse covers a wider range of tasks than the job title suggests. Our operatives are briefed and expected to handle:
- Picking products from warehouse shelves — using pick lists, RF scanners, voice picking headsets or pick-to-light systems.
- Packing goods securely for dispatch — selecting correct carton size, applying void fill, sealing and weighing parcels.
- Labelling and preparing orders — printing courier labels, applying barcodes, separating by carrier and service level.
- Checking stock accuracy — quality-checking SKUs against orders, flagging short-picks, supporting cycle counts.
- Supporting loading, sorting and dispatch tasks — moving cages, palletising, loading trailers, putaway from goods-in.
- Replenishment — refilling pick faces from reserve stock to keep the line moving.
- General warehouse duties — sweeping aisles, recycling cardboard, supporting goods-in and returns processing.
⭐ Featured Snippet — Pick and Pack Definition
Pick and pack is a warehouse fulfilment process in which an operative selects ordered items from inventory storage locations (picking) and prepares them for shipment in protective packaging (packing). It is the core workflow of e-commerce warehousing companies, third party warehouse services, and 3PL warehousing and distribution providers.

10. Live Picker & Packer Vacancies — Indicative Rates
The table below shows current temporary picker and packer vacancies and indicative hourly rates across our network — all above the UK National Living Wage. Rates vary by shift, employer and location.
| Job Title | Description | Hourly Rate | Apply / View |
|---|---|---|---|
| Order Picker (Manchester) | RF-scanner picking in fast-paced fulfilment warehouse, Trafford Park. | £12.80–£14.50 | View |
| Warehouse Packer | E-commerce parcel packing, label application and dispatch prep. | £12.50–£13.80 | View |
| Voice Picker | Voice-directed picking for grocery and ambient distribution centres. | £13.20–£15.00 | View |
| Cold Store Picker | Refrigerated warehouse picking, –18°C kit provided. Salford area. | £14.00–£16.20 | View |
| Pick & Pack Operative (Nights) | 10pm–6am shift, e-commerce fulfilment with night premium. | £14.50–£16.50 | View |
| Distribution Centre Picker | RDC pallet/case picking, MHE-friendly site, Heywood/Bury area. | £13.00–£14.80 | View |
| Returns Sorter / Packer | Returns inspection, repacking and putaway for fashion e-commerce. | £12.50–£13.50 | View |
| Fulfilment Operative (Weekend) | Sat/Sun pick-pack cover, 12hr shifts, premium weekend rate. | £13.50–£15.00 | View |
| Bonded Warehouse Picker | Customs bonded warehouse picking, alcohol/tobacco SKU experience. | £13.80–£15.50 | View |
| Cross-Dock Operative | Cross-docking warehouse, inbound sortation, parcel hub. | £12.80–£14.00 | View |
| Goods-In Picker | Inbound putaway, pallet checking, stock location updates. | £12.50–£13.80 | View |
| Senior Pick-Pack Team Lead | Shift supervision, pick-zone allocation, KPI reporting. | £15.50–£17.50 | View |
Rates indicative as of April 2026. Final rates depend on shift, employer, experience and start date. All rates exceed the UK National Living Wage.
